WHAT IS CETANE? Simply put, cetane is a chemical compound found naturally in diesel that ignites easily under pressure. Because of its high flammability, it serves as the industry standard for evaluating fuel combustion quality. Specifically, this measure is referred to as the cetane number. The higher the cetane number, the more easily the fuel can be ignited. This, of course, translates into a smoother running, better performing engine with more power and fewer harmful emissions. WHAT IS OCTANE? Octane is an organic molecule. It is an alkane of eight carbon atoms (C8H18). It contains several isomers of which the most important is trimethylpentane called isooctane. This is referenced as 100 on the octane scale. Octane or octane number is a measure of the quality and anti-knock capacity of a gasoline engine. METALLOCENES: In 1974, Otto Fischer and Geoffrey Wilkinson shared the Nobel Prize “for their pioneering work, carried out independently, in the chemistry of organometals, called Sandwich compounds”, among which ferrocene is mainly found, Figure 10. However, this compound was synthesized for the first time, albeit accidentally and almost simultaneously, by Kealy and Pauson and by Miller, Tebboth and Tremaine, who made a mistake in formulating the compound obtained. It was Woodward and Wilkinson at Harvard University, and Fischer at the Technical University of Munich who quickly understood that the properties of this new compound could not be explained by the structures proposed by its discoverers. It was Woodward who named the new compound ferrocene, by analogy with benzene and its extraordinary stability. The interesting thing about ferrocene is that it presented a new type of metal-carbon bond. This compound also presented an unusual type of molecular architecture that could be exploited to design polymerization reaction catalysts. Likewise, the particular structure of ferrocene plays an important role in the development of the different liquid crystalline phases of the synthesized derivatives.
